Transaction d156842f605b26641b8d5293d035fea4fcd7a80c7fb48bb6804617a72e660638
1 Input
1 Output
-
d156842f605b26641b8d5293d035fea4fcd7a80c7fb48bb6804617a72e660638:0
- value
- 2253472541
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2b194e7ba703011d5dee0f9105e7cb3936347ef
- address
- bc1q62cefea6wqcpr4w7uru3qhnukwfkx3l0wlxn4h